Least Common Multiple of 89215 and 89233 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 89215 and 89233,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(89215,89233) = 1
LCM(89215,89233) = ( 89215 × 89233) / 1
LCM(89215,89233) = 7960922095 / 1
LCM(89215,89233) = 7960922095
